A couple of weeks ago a reader requested a baked beans recipe. Here is one that my family loves.
Ingredients:
- 2 lbs navy beans, canned, drained
- 1 lb bacon, diced
- 2 medium white onions, diced
- 1 red pepper, diced
- 1 green pepper, diced
- 20 oz water
- 1/2 cup your favorite bourbon
- 1/2 cup cola
- 1 box dark brown sugar
- 4 Tbsp ketchup
- 4 Tbsp BBQ sauce
- 6 Tbsp molasses
- 2 Tbsp tomato paste
- 3 Tbsp Sriracha
Baked Beans
- Take the beans and cook them in a pot on simmer until tender for about 45 minutes.
- Drain the beans and set aside.
- In a heavy bottomed pot cook the bacon until crispy.
- Add the diced onions and peppers and sauté until soft.
- Add the beans, water, bourbon, coke, brown sugar, ketchup, BBQ sauce, molasses, tomato paste, Sriracha
- Bring everything to a low boil for about an hour stirring frequently and then simmer for 2 hours.
- Turn the heat off and let it sit on the stove for about 2 hours to cool, then refrigerate overnight
Now here is the cheat, transfer the beans to a crock pot on high and heat for another 4 hours and then they will be ready to enjoy!
